    About the last line........

    by kai_mah'gra

    .........in the trailer, which everyone is bitching about ("....one wild night"): how many times in movies, or more specifically trailers, have you seen the studio using lines, or even entire scenes, for the trailer, that eventually don't make it into the final cut in the movie? I'm willing to bet you that by the time this hits theatresin March, they will have edited in another take of that scene with a different line (like "This will be a night for the ages", or something like that) or just left it out, on the cutting rooom floor, altogether. I'm guessing they decided to use it for the trailer primarily for marketing purposes and to reach a younger demographic audience (smells like a silly studio exec's or a suit's dumbass idea). I highly doubt that Miller (who had more consulting input andmore say in general, on this movie than he did on Sin City where he was even a c-director, nor Snyder for that matter, will leave that line in. Calm your silly little selves down. Oh, and for those clueless few still left out there, the movie is based directly (as in heavily inspired by) on the graphic novel of the same name by Frank Miller;; itself, which is, in turn, a loosely based, and highly stylized and sensationalised re-depiction of the historically factual battle of Thermopyle. An account that has been re-told numerous times by various less-accurate scribes through the ages such as Pressfield's Gate's of Fire, most recently. So, if you're looking for historical accuracy here, then you're about 4-5 layers way off the mark.

    Calm Down Haters

    by alexander luthor

    It seems silly to attack a movie which is obviously not pretending to be a historically accurate retelling of the battle of Thermopylae. The story is heavily stylized. The comic (sorry, but graphic novel sounds so phony) is a stylized, superhero-tinged representation of the battle of the 200 Spartans against the Persian Empire. The use of monsters, elephants, giants and the stark and stunning color palette is (I can only assume from having read the book) meant not to poke fun at or disrespect what happened. Rather, these artistic liberties are meant to do two things. 1) to emphasize the heroism of the 300 Spartans and demonstrate what a massive undertaking it was for them to stand against an Imperial army in defense of their lands when their own country men couldn't be bothered to do so. And 2...to make everything in the story look cool as shit by implementing all kinds of fantasy and comic book-like elements in the story. Really, there's already been a move about the 300 Spartans. And there have already been books. What Frank Miller did was take a group of real examples of 'super humans' and tell a story of their feats in the traditional superhero medium of comics. It's not meant to be pretentious, terribly inciteful or (of all things) historically accurate. It's meant to be big. As big as Superman punching a robot attacking Metropolis or the X-Men facing down Magneto and the Brotherhood of Mutants.

    If you are looking for historical accuracy and choose not to watch the movie I understand you. That is anyone's right. But the hating is really a weird thing. I don't understand the level of anger behind it. I am new to this (1st post). But I don't think I expected this.

    Finally, on the look of the film: It's obvious that the director of this film if going for the same look as Miller's comic (yes he's not made an arty movie or some looked-over masterpiece that everyone tells me I have to see but I still think even previously bad directors can make good movies...and vice versa). The slow motion, green screens and speech are meant to bring the life of the comic to the screen (writers use screaming captions in comics to emphasize emotion in the face of the limitations of the medium ...for those of you who don't know already). In this sense, this movie is very accurate in protraying the STORY that is '300' as opposed to the story OF the 300 Spartans.

    Any way you slice it I think this is my favorite trailer of the year and I am looking forward to this as much as Spider-Man 3 next year. This is SPARTA!!!!!

    And for the record, there were 300 Spartans sire fighters (basically soldiers that new ther were gonna die) and 5000 other Greek warriors against an army of possibly as many as 2 million Persians. The figures are not important nor can they be accurately verified in any meaningful way. The point is that the Spartans were way outnumbered and knew they were gonna die but stood and fought an impossible fight against a monstrous enemy. And in the end, as Leonidas takes down the Persian 'god' Xerxes and forces Greece to unite against the Persian invaders, the 300 Spartans become more than men. They become super heroes.
